Ingredients
- 3½ ounces fresh ginger, peeled
- 2 teaspoons ground ginger
- 2 tablespoons baobab powder
- 1/4 cup coconut sugar (or sticky brown sugar)
- 2 large lemons, juice of both and zest of 1 (if you like)
- 1 cup just-boiled water
- 1 (750-milliliter) bottle sparkling water
- fresh mint, lemon slices and lots of ice, to serve
Chef notes
The floral and citrusy flavor of baobab powder makes this invigorating ginger beer even more refreshing. Using fresh and ground ginger really amplifies the naturally sharp zing of the aromatic root.
Preparation
Blitz the fresh ginger and baobab powder in a handheld blender or food processor. Mix all of the ingredients except the water together in a small pot, add in water and simmer for 5-10 minutes, or until the sugar has dissolved. Leave to cool and steep for a further 5-10 minutes.
Strain the mixture to a glass jug or wide-necked bottle, top with sparkling water, adjust to taste and refrigerate until needed, or serve immediately over ice with fresh mint and lemon wedges.
